Renault Kangoo:
The Renault Kangoo is a family of vans built by Renault since 1997 across three generations. It is sold as a passenger multi-purpose vehicle or as a light commercial vehicle. For the European market, the Kangoo is manufactured at the MCA plant in Maubeuge, France.
The Kangoo was also marketed as a rebadged variant by Nissan in Europe as the Nissan Kubistar , Nissan NV250 and Nissan Townstar. In September 2012, Mercedes-Benz began marketing a rebadged variant of the second generation Kangoo as the Mercedes-Benz Citan, which is also marketed as Mercedes EQT and Mercedes T-Class for the current generation....(Read more on Wikipedia)

| General: |
| Brand: | Renault |
| Model: | Kangoo |
| Generation: | II Express (facelift 2013) |
| Modification (Engine): | 1.2 TCe (115 Hp) EDC |
| Start of production: | 2013 |
| End of production: | 2015 |
| Powertrain Architecture: | Internal Combustion engine |
| Body type: | Minivan |
| Seats: | 2 |
| Doors: | 3 |
| Engine: |
| Power: | 115 Hp @ 4500 rpm. Same horsepower |
| Power per litre: | 96.1 Hp/l [315mm less] |
| Torque: | 190 Nm @ 2000 rpm. |
| Engine Model/Code: | H5FT More details about the engine H5FT |
| Engine displacement: | 1197 |
| Number of cylinders: | 4 |
| Engine configuration: | Inline |
| Number of valves per cylinder: | 4 |
| Fuel injection system: | Direct injection |
| Engine aspiration: | Turbocharger, Intercooler |
| Engine oil capacity: | 4.2 l |
| Coolant: | 6.9 l |
| Engine layout: | Front, Transverse |
| Performance: |
| Fuel Type: | Petrol (Gasoline) |
| Fuel consumption (economy) - combined: | 6.4-6.5 l/100 km |
| Emission standard: | Euro 5 |
| Acceleration 0 - 100 km/h: | 10.4 sec |
| Acceleration 0 - 62 mph: | 10.4 sec |
| Maximum speed: | 172 km/h |
| Weight-to-power ratio: | 11 kg/Hp, 90.6 Hp/tonne |
| Weight-to-torque ratio: | 6.7 kg/Nm, 149.6 Nm/tonne |
| Acceleration 0 - 60 mph: | 9.9 sec |
